Popular Myths about Teeth Whitening

Myth 1: You Can Opt For Whitening With Crowns, Veneers, and Fillings.

Truth: Unfortunately, dental treatments like crowns, veneers, and fillings cannot be whitened. The surface of veneers and crowns is impermeable and does not let bleaching agents get in. Only natural tooth enamel responds to the whitening process.

Myth 2: Oil Pulling Is An Effective Whitening Treatment.

Truth: Although oil pulling, which includes swishing coconut oil in your mouth, is a readily used natural remedy, there is no actual scientific representation or link to support its effectiveness in teeth whitening. Relying entirely on the oil-pulling method may not give the results you are looking for, and it is best to consult a dentist for professional whitening options.

Myth 3: Do Not Go For Whitening If You Have Sensitive Teeth.

Truth: Having sensitive teeth does not warrant not whitening them. Qualified dentist care experts can tailor the treatment according to your feasibility to minimize discomfort and sensitivity during the procedure.

Myth 4: Acidic Fruits Aid in Teeth Whitening.

Truth: It is a popular belief among people that fruits like lemons and strawberries have whitening properties; however, there is no scientific truth to it. In fact, these acidic fruits produce the exact opposite results. They can erode tooth enamel, causing more harm than good.

Myth 5: Teeth Whitening is Harmful to Tooth Enamel.

Truth: Teeth whitening, when done correctly by a qualified dentist, does no harm to tooth enamel. This is because professional dental care experts’ use high-quality whitening gels that open the pores on the tooth’s surface to remove stains effectively. This process is safe and effective when done properly.

Teeth Whitening Facts

1. Professional Whitening Products Produce Better Results Compared to Drugstore Kits

Fact: A professional uses stronger whitening gels at safe limits compared to over-the-counter products, which leads to better, more effective results.

2. It is A Fast and Convenient Procedure

Fact: Zoom teeth whitening is the most sought option for those who seek rapid results. Before the treatment, your dentist will thoroughly screen your oral cavity to ensure your gums and teeth are in the best shape, minimizing potential complications.

3. There Is a Pre-Whitening Teeth Cleaning Session

Fact: It is true; dentists first perform teeth cleaning to lay the foundation for a successful Zoom teeth whitening procedure. This step ensures that all plaque build-up is gotten rid of, allowing the whitening treatment to work its magic more effectively.

4. Children Should Wait Until They Are Adults to Get Teeth Whitening

Fact: As their teeth are under development, it is best not to deal with stained or discolored teeth immediately. During this time, whitening procedures may negatively affect developing teeth, so it is best to consult a pediatric dentist for this.
